Golf Course Description

This facility has two Tom Fazio eighteen hole championship courses and a nine hole executive course. Pine Barrens is the signature course for the club. It is a tight, intimidating layout named for its large number of pine trees and barren waste areas. The design demands many long carry shots over waste areas, as well as delicate placement shots to small landing areas. Generally, trees come into play on either the left or right side of each fairway, but rarely both. Two small lakes also come into play on this course. “Golf Digest” rated Pine Barrens as the 3rd “Best Public Course” in the state, and the 8th “Best in State” course from 1995 through 1998. “GOLF Magazine” chose it 11th among the “Top 100 Courses You Can Play in the U.S.” for 1998, 38th among the “Top 100 Courses in the U.S.” for 1997 and 1999, and 39th in the same category for 1995. “GOLFWEEK” awarded it 13th in the category of “America’s 100 Best Modern Courses” for 1997, 11th for 1998 and 9th for 1999. The Rolling Oaks Course is a traditional design with rolling fairways lined with live oaks, dogwood, and magnolia trees. The large greens feature multiple tiers and cavernous protective bunkers. Azaleas are planted along the manicured fairways and greens. Water hazards (two lakes) come into play on three holes. “Golf Digest” rated the Rolling Oaks course as the 6th “Best Public Course” in the state for 1996, and they also ranked it 73rd among the “Top 75 Upscale Courses” for the same year. The same publication rated it the 19th “Best in State” course for 1995-96, and 26th best for 1997-98. “GOLF Magazine” has selected the Rolling Oaks Course 33rd among the “Top 100 Courses You Can Play in the U.S.” for 1998. “GOLFWEEK” awarded it 67th among “America’s 100 Best Modern Courses” for 1997, 76th for 1998 and 63rd for 1999. Locals consider the nine hole Irons Course as a great place for beginning and junior golfers, plus it’s also an excellent facility for practicing your short game. This club additionally boasts of having one of the finest practice facilities in the country. World Woods offers three challenging practice holes, including a par 3, 4, and 5. A circular driving range covers over twenty-two acres of land and features eight separate teeing areas, including target greens, bunkers, and trees. The circular shape offers an opportunity to practice under various wind and sun conditions. Sand bunkers and chipping greens are also a part of the practice area. The putting course consists of two acres of undulating greens that guarantees a challenge to everyone.
